@node Auto-Indentation
|
||||
@section Auto-indention of code
|
||||
|
||||
For programming languages, an important feature of a major mode is to
|
||||
provide automatic indentation. This is controlled in Emacs by
|
||||
@code{indent-line-function} (@pxref{Mode-Specific Indent}).
|
||||
Writing a good indentation function can be difficult and to a large
|
||||
extent it is still a black art.
|
||||
|
||||
Many major mode authors will start by writing a simple indentation
|
||||
function that works for simple cases, for example by comparing with the
|
||||
indentation of the previous text line. For most programming languages
|
||||
that are not really line-based, this tends to scale very poorly:
|
||||
improving such a function to let it handle more diverse situations tends
|
||||
to become more and more difficult, resulting in the end with a large,
|
||||
complex, unmaintainable indentation function which nobody dares to touch.
|
||||
|
||||
A good indentation function will usually need to actually parse the
|
||||
text, according to the syntax of the language. Luckily, it is not
|
||||
necessary to parse the text in as much detail as would be needed
|
||||
for a compiler, but on the other hand, the parser embedded in the
|
||||
indentation code will want to be somewhat friendly to syntactically
|
||||
incorrect code.
|
||||
|
||||
Good maintainable indentation functions usually fall into 2 categories:
|
||||
either parsing forward from some ``safe'' starting point until the
|
||||
position of interest, or parsing backward from the position of interest.
|
||||
Neither of the two is a clearly better choice than the other: parsing
|
||||
backward is often more difficult than parsing forward because
|
||||
programming languages are designed to be parsed forward, but for the
|
||||
purpose of indentation it has the advantage of not needing to
|
||||
guess a ``safe'' starting point, and it generally enjoys the property
|
||||
that only a minimum of text will be analyzed to decide the indentation
|
||||
of a line, so indentation will tend to be unaffected by syntax errors in
|
||||
some earlier unrelated piece of code. Parsing forward on the other hand
|
||||
is usually easier and has the advantage of making it possible to
|
||||
reindent efficiently a whole region at a time, with a single parse.
|
||||
|
||||
Rather than write your own indentation function from scratch, it is
|
||||
often preferable to try and reuse some existing ones or to rely
|
||||
on a generic indentation engine. There are sadly few such
|
||||
engines. The CC-mode indentation code (used with C, C++, Java, Awk
|
||||
and a few other such modes) has been made more generic over the years,
|
||||
so if your language seems somewhat similar to one of those languages,
|
||||
you might try to use that engine. @c FIXME: documentation?
|
||||
Another one is SMIE which takes an approach in the spirit
|
||||
of Lisp sexps and adapts it to non-Lisp languages.
|

@node SMIE
|
||||
@subsection Simple Minded Indentation Engine
|
||||
|
||||
SMIE is a package that provides a generic navigation and indentation
|
||||
engine. Based on a very simple parser using an ``operator precedence
|
||||
grammar'', it lets major modes extend the sexp-based navigation of Lisp
|
||||
to non-Lisp languages as well as provide a simple to use but reliable
|
||||
auto-indentation.
|
||||
|
||||
Operator precedence grammar is a very primitive technology for parsing
|
||||
compared to some of the more common techniques used in compilers.
|
||||
It has the following characteristics: its parsing power is very limited,
|
||||
and it is largely unable to detect syntax errors, but it has the
|
||||
advantage of being algorithmically efficient and able to parse forward
|
||||
just as well as backward. In practice that means that SMIE can use it
|
||||
for indentation based on backward parsing, that it can provide both
|
||||
@code{forward-sexp} and @code{backward-sexp} functionality, and that it
|
||||
will naturally work on syntactically incorrect code without any extra
|
||||
effort. The downside is that it also means that most programming
|
||||
languages cannot be parsed correctly using SMIE, at least not without
|
||||
resorting to some special tricks (@pxref{SMIE Tricks}).

@node SMIE setup
|
||||
@subsubsection SMIE Setup and Features
|
||||
|
||||
SMIE is meant to be a one-stop shop for structural navigation and
|
||||
various other features which rely on the syntactic structure of code, in
|
||||
particular automatic indentation. The main entry point is
|
||||
@code{smie-setup} which is a function typically called while setting
|
||||
up a major mode.
|
||||
|
||||
@defun smie-setup grammar rules-function &rest keywords
|
||||
Setup SMIE navigation and indentation.
|
||||
@var{grammar} is a grammar table generated by @code{smie-prec2->grammar}.
|
||||
@var{rules-function} is a set of indentation rules for use on
|
||||
@code{smie-rules-function}.
|
||||
@var{keywords} are additional arguments, which can include the following
|
||||
keywords:
|
||||
@itemize
|
||||
@item
|
||||
@code{:forward-token} @var{fun}: Specify the forward lexer to use.
|
||||
@item
|
||||
@code{:backward-token} @var{fun}: Specify the backward lexer to use.
|
||||
@end itemize
|
||||
@end defun
|
||||
|
||||
Calling this function is sufficient to make commands such as
|
||||
@code{forward-sexp}, @code{backward-sexp}, and @code{transpose-sexps} be
|
||||
able to properly handle structural elements other than just the paired
|
||||
parentheses already handled by syntax tables. For example, if the
|
||||
provided grammar is precise enough, @code{transpose-sexps} can correctly
|
||||
transpose the two arguments of a @code{+} operator, taking into account
|
||||
the precedence rules of the language.
|
||||
|
||||
Calling `smie-setup' is also sufficient to make TAB indentation work in
|
||||
the expected way, and provides some commands that you can bind in the
|
||||
major mode keymap.
|
||||
|
||||
@deffn Command smie-close-block
|
||||
This command closes the most recently opened (and not yet closed) block.
|
||||
@end deffn
|
||||
|
||||
@deffn Command smie-down-list &optional arg
|
||||
This command is like @code{down-list} but it also pays attention to
|
||||
nesting of tokens other than parentheses, such as @code{begin...end}.
|
||||
@end deffn
|

@node Operator Precedence Grammars
|
||||
@subsubsection Operator Precedence Grammars
|
||||
|
||||
SMIE's precedence grammars simply give to each token a pair of
|
||||
precedences: the left-precedence and the right-precedence. We say
|
||||
@code{T1 < T2} if the right-precedence of token @code{T1} is less than
|
||||
the left-precedence of token @code{T2}. A good way to read this
|
||||
@code{<} is as a kind of parenthesis: if we find @code{... T1 something
|
||||
T2 ...} then that should be parsed as @code{... T1 (something T2 ...}
|
||||
rather than as @code{... T1 something) T2 ...}. The latter
|
||||
interpretation would be the case if we had @code{T1 > T2}. If we have
|
||||
@code{T1 = T2}, it means that token T2 follows token T1 in the same
|
||||
syntactic construction, so typically we have @code{"begin" = "end"}.
|
||||
Such pairs of precedences are sufficient to express left-associativity
|
||||
or right-associativity of infix operators, nesting of tokens like
|
||||
parentheses and many other cases.
|
||||
|
||||
@c ¡Let's leave this undocumented to leave it more open for change!
|
||||
@c @defvar smie-grammar
|
||||
@c The value of this variable is an alist specifying the left and right
|
||||
@c precedence of each token. It is meant to be initialized by using one of
|
||||
@c the functions below.
|
||||
@c @end defvar
|
||||
|
||||
@defun smie-prec2->grammar table
|
||||
This function takes a @emph{prec2} grammar @var{table} and returns an
|
||||
alist suitable for use in @code{smie-setup}. The @emph{prec2}
|
||||
@var{table} is itself meant to be built by one of the functions below.
|
||||
@end defun
|
||||
|
||||
@defun smie-merge-prec2s &rest tables
|
||||
This function takes several @emph{prec2} @var{tables} and merges them
|
||||
into a new @emph{prec2} table.
|
||||
@end defun
|
||||
|
||||
@defun smie-precs->prec2 precs
|
||||
This function builds a @emph{prec2} table from a table of precedences
|
||||
@var{precs}. @var{precs} should be a list, sorted by precedence (for
|
||||
example @code{"+"} will come before @code{"*"}), of elements of the form
|
||||
@code{(@var{assoc} @var{op} ...)}, where each @var{op} is a token that
|
||||
acts as an operator; @var{assoc} is their associativity, which can be
|
||||
either @code{left}, @code{right}, @code{assoc}, or @code{nonassoc}.
|
||||
All operators in a given element share the same precedence level
|
||||
and associativity.
|
||||
@end defun
|
||||
|
||||
@defun smie-bnf->prec2 bnf &rest resolvers
|
||||
This function lets you specify the grammar using a BNF notation.
|
||||
It accepts a @var{bnf} description of the grammar along with a set of
|
||||
conflict resolution rules @var{resolvers}, and
|
||||
returns a @emph{prec2} table.
|
||||
|
||||
@var{bnf} is a list of nonterminal definitions of the form
|
||||
@code{(@var{nonterm} @var{rhs1} @var{rhs2} ...)} where each @var{rhs}
|
||||
is a (non-empty) list of terminals (aka tokens) or non-terminals.
|
||||
|
||||
Not all grammars are accepted:
|
||||
@itemize
|
||||
@item
|
||||
An @var{rhs} cannot be an empty list (an empty list is never needed,
|
||||
since SMIE allows all non-terminals to match the empty string anyway).
|
||||
@item
|
||||
An @var{rhs} cannot have 2 consecutive non-terminals: each pair of
|
||||
non-terminals needs to be separated by a terminal (aka token).
|
||||
This is a fundamental limitation of operator precedence grammars.
|
||||
@end itemize
|
||||
|
||||
Additionally, conflicts can occur:
|
||||
@itemize
|
||||
@item
|
||||
The returned @emph{prec2} table holds constraints between pairs of tokens, and
|
||||
for any given pair only one constraint can be present: T1 < T2,
|
||||
T1 = T2, or T1 > T2.
|
||||
@item
|
||||
A token can be an @code{opener} (something similar to an open-paren),
|
||||
a @code{closer} (like a close-paren), or @code{neither} of the two
|
||||
(e.g. an infix operator, or an inner token like @code{"else"}).
|
||||
@end itemize
|
||||
|
||||
Precedence conflicts can be resolved via @var{resolvers}, which
|
||||
is a list of @emph{precs} tables (see @code{smie-precs->prec2}): for
|
||||
each precedence conflict, if those @code{precs} tables
|
||||
specify a particular constraint, then the conflict is resolved by using
|
||||
this constraint instead, else a conflict is reported and one of the
|
||||
conflicting constraints is picked arbitrarily and the others are
|
||||
simply ignored.
|
||||
@end defun

@node SMIE Grammar
|
||||
@subsubsection Defining the Grammar of a Language
|
||||
|
||||
The usual way to define the SMIE grammar of a language is by
|
||||
defining a new global variable that holds the precedence table by
|
||||
giving a set of BNF rules.
|
||||
For example, the grammar definition for a small Pascal-like language
|
||||
could look like:
|
||||
@example
|
||||
@group
|
||||
(require 'smie)
|
||||
(defvar sample-smie-grammar
|
||||
(smie-prec2->grammar
|
||||
(smie-bnf->prec2
|
||||
@end group
|
||||
@group
|
||||
'((id)
|
||||
(inst ("begin" insts "end")
|
||||
("if" exp "then" inst "else" inst)
|
||||
(id ":=" exp)
|
||||
(exp))
|
||||
(insts (insts ";" insts) (inst))
|
||||
(exp (exp "+" exp)
|
||||
(exp "*" exp)
|
||||
("(" exps ")"))
|
||||
(exps (exps "," exps) (exp)))
|
||||
@end group
|
||||
@group
|
||||
'((assoc ";"))
|
||||
'((assoc ","))
|
||||
'((assoc "+") (assoc "*")))))
|
||||
@end group
|
||||
@end example
|
||||
|
||||
@noindent
|
||||
A few things to note:
|
||||
|
||||
@itemize
|
||||
@item
|
||||
The above grammar does not explicitly mention the syntax of function
|
||||
calls: SMIE will automatically allow any sequence of sexps, such as
|
||||
identifiers, balanced parentheses, or @code{begin ... end} blocks
|
||||
to appear anywhere anyway.
|
||||
@item
|
||||
The grammar category @code{id} has no right hand side: this does not
|
||||
mean that it can match only the empty string, since as mentioned any
|
||||
sequence of sexps can appear anywhere anyway.
|
||||
@item
|
||||
Because non terminals cannot appear consecutively in the BNF grammar, it
|
||||
is difficult to correctly handle tokens that act as terminators, so the
|
||||
above grammar treats @code{";"} as a statement @emph{separator} instead,
|
||||
which SMIE can handle very well.
|
||||
@item
|
||||
Separators used in sequences (such as @code{","} and @code{";"} above)
|
||||
are best defined with BNF rules such as @code{(foo (foo "separator" foo) ...)}
|
||||
which generate precedence conflicts which are then resolved by giving
|
||||
them an explicit @code{(assoc "separator")}.
|
||||
@item
|
||||
The @code{("(" exps ")")} rule was not needed to pair up parens, since
|
||||
SMIE will pair up any characters that are marked as having paren syntax
|
||||
in the syntax table. What this rule does instead (together with the
|
||||
definition of @code{exps}) is to make it clear that @code{","} should
|
||||
not appear outside of parentheses.
|
||||
@item
|
||||
Rather than have a single @emph{precs} table to resolve conflicts, it is
|
||||
preferable to have several tables, so as to let the BNF part of the
|
||||
grammar specify relative precedences where possible.
|
||||
@item
|
||||
Unless there is a very good reason to prefer @code{left} or
|
||||
@code{right}, it is usually preferable to mark operators as associative,
|
||||
using @code{assoc}. For that reason @code{"+"} and @code{"*"} are
|
||||
defined above as @code{assoc}, although the language defines them
|
||||
formally as left associative.
|
||||
@end itemize
|

@node SMIE Lexer
|
||||
@subsubsection Defining Tokens
|
||||
|
||||
SMIE comes with a predefined lexical analyzer which uses syntax tables
|
||||
in the following way: any sequence of characters that have word or
|
||||
symbol syntax is considered a token, and so is any sequence of
|
||||
characters that have punctuation syntax. This default lexer is
|
||||
often a good starting point but is rarely actually correct for any given
|
||||
language. For example, it will consider @code{"2,+3"} to be composed
|
||||
of 3 tokens: @code{"2"}, @code{",+"}, and @code{"3"}.
|
||||
|
||||
To describe the lexing rules of your language to SMIE, you need
|
||||
2 functions, one to fetch the next token, and another to fetch the
|
||||
previous token. Those functions will usually first skip whitespace and
|
||||
comments and then look at the next chunk of text to see if it
|
||||
is a special token. If so it should skip the token and
|
||||
return a description of this token. Usually this is simply the string
|
||||
extracted from the buffer, but it can be anything you want.
|
||||
For example:
|
||||
@example
|
||||
@group
|
||||
(defvar sample-keywords-regexp
|
||||
(regexp-opt '("+" "*" "," ";" ">" ">=" "<" "<=" ":=" "=")))
|
||||
@end group
|
||||
@group
|
||||
(defun sample-smie-forward-token ()
|
||||
(forward-comment (point-max))
|
||||
(cond
|
||||
((looking-at sample-keywords-regexp)
|
||||
(goto-char (match-end 0))
|
||||
(match-string-no-properties 0))
|
||||
(t (buffer-substring-no-properties
|
||||
(point)
|
||||
(progn (skip-syntax-forward "w_")
|
||||
(point))))))
|
||||
@end group
|
||||
@group
|
||||
(defun sample-smie-backward-token ()
|
||||
(forward-comment (- (point)))
|
||||
(cond
|
||||
((looking-back sample-keywords-regexp (- (point) 2) t)
|
||||
(goto-char (match-beginning 0))
|
||||
(match-string-no-properties 0))
|
||||
(t (buffer-substring-no-properties
|
||||
(point)
|
||||
(progn (skip-syntax-backward "w_")
|
||||
(point))))))
|
||||
@end group
|
||||
@end example
|
||||
|
||||
Notice how those lexers return the empty string when in front of
|
||||
parentheses. This is because SMIE automatically takes care of the
|
||||
parentheses defined in the syntax table. More specifically if the lexer
|
||||
returns nil or an empty string, SMIE tries to handle the corresponding
|
||||
text as a sexp according to syntax tables.
|

@node SMIE Tricks
|
||||
@subsubsection Living With a Weak Parser
|
||||
|
||||
The parsing technique used by SMIE does not allow tokens to behave
|
||||
differently in different contexts. For most programming languages, this
|
||||
manifests itself by precedence conflicts when converting the
|
||||
BNF grammar.
|
||||
|
||||
Sometimes, those conflicts can be worked around by expressing the
|
||||
grammar slightly differently. For example, for Modula-2 it might seem
|
||||
natural to have a BNF grammar that looks like this:
|
||||
|
||||
@example
|
||||
...
|
||||
(inst ("IF" exp "THEN" insts "ELSE" insts "END")
|
||||
("CASE" exp "OF" cases "END")
|
||||
...)
|
||||
(cases (cases "|" cases) (caselabel ":" insts) ("ELSE" insts))
|
||||
...
|
||||
@end example
|
||||
|
||||
But this will create conflicts for @code{"ELSE"}: on the one hand, the
|
||||
IF rule implies (among many other things) that @code{"ELSE" = "END"};
|
||||
but on the other hand, since @code{"ELSE"} appears within @code{cases},
|
||||
which appears left of @code{"END"}, we also have @code{"ELSE" > "END"}.
|
||||
We can solve the conflict either by using:
|
||||
@example
|
||||
...
|
||||
(inst ("IF" exp "THEN" insts "ELSE" insts "END")
|
||||
("CASE" exp "OF" cases "END")
|
||||
("CASE" exp "OF" cases "ELSE" insts "END")
|
||||
...)
|
||||
(cases (cases "|" cases) (caselabel ":" insts))
|
||||
...
|
||||
@end example
|
||||
or
|
||||
@example
|
||||
...
|
||||
(inst ("IF" exp "THEN" else "END")
|
||||
("CASE" exp "OF" cases "END")
|
||||
...)
|
||||
(else (insts "ELSE" insts))
|
||||
(cases (cases "|" cases) (caselabel ":" insts) (else))
|
||||
...
|
||||
@end example
|
||||
|
||||
Reworking the grammar to try and solve conflicts has its downsides, tho,
|
||||
because SMIE assumes that the grammar reflects the logical structure of
|
||||
the code, so it is preferable to keep the BNF closer to the intended
|
||||
abstract syntax tree.
|
||||
|
||||
Other times, after careful consideration you may conclude that those
|
||||
conflicts are not serious and simply resolve them via the
|
||||
@var{resolvers} argument of @code{smie-bnf->prec2}. Usually this is
|
||||
because the grammar is simply ambiguous: the conflict does not affect
|
||||
the set of programs described by the grammar, but only the way those
|
||||
programs are parsed. This is typically the case for separators and
|
||||
associative infix operators, where you want to add a resolver like
|
||||
@code{'((assoc "|"))}. Another case where this can happen is for the
|
||||
classic @emph{dangling else} problem, where you will use @code{'((assoc
|
||||
"else" "then"))}. It can also happen for cases where the conflict is
|
||||
real and cannot really be resolved, but it is unlikely to pose a problem
|
||||
in practice.
|
||||
|
||||
Finally, in many cases some conflicts will remain despite all efforts to
|
||||
restructure the grammar. Do not despair: while the parser cannot be
|
||||
made more clever, you can make the lexer as smart as you want. So, the
|
||||
solution is then to look at the tokens involved in the conflict and to
|
||||
split one of those tokens into 2 (or more) different tokens. E.g. if
|
||||
the grammar needs to distinguish between two incompatible uses of the
|
||||
token @code{"begin"}, make the lexer return different tokens (say
|
||||
@code{"begin-fun"} and @code{"begin-plain"}) depending on which kind of
|
||||
@code{"begin"} it finds. This pushes the work of distinguishing the
|
||||
different cases to the lexer, which will thus have to look at the
|
||||
surrounding text to find ad-hoc clues.
|

@node SMIE Indentation
|
||||
@subsubsection Specifying Indentation Rules
|
||||
|
||||
Based on the provided grammar, SMIE will be able to provide automatic
|
||||
indentation without any extra effort. But in practice, this default
|
||||
indentation style will probably not be good enough. You will want to
|
||||
tweak it in many different cases.
|
||||
|
||||
SMIE indentation is based on the idea that indentation rules should be
|
||||
as local as possible. To this end, it relies on the idea of
|
||||
@emph{virtual} indentation, which is the indentation that a particular
|
||||
program point would have if it were at the beginning of a line.
|
||||
Of course, if that program point is indeed at the beginning of a line,
|
||||
its virtual indentation is its current indentation. But if not, then
|
||||
SMIE uses the indentation algorithm to compute the virtual indentation
|
||||
of that point. Now in practice, the virtual indentation of a program
|
||||
point does not have to be identical to the indentation it would have if
|
||||
we inserted a newline before it. To see how this works, the SMIE rule
|
||||
for indentation after a @code{@{} in C does not care whether the
|
||||
@code{@{} is standing on a line of its own or is at the end of the
|
||||
preceding line. Instead, these different cases are handled in the
|
||||
indentation rule that decides how to indent before a @code{@{}.
|
||||
|
||||
Another important concept is the notion of @emph{parent}: The
|
||||
@emph{parent} of a token, is the head token of the nearest enclosing
|
||||
syntactic construct. For example, the parent of an @code{else} is the
|
||||
@code{if} to which it belongs, and the parent of an @code{if}, in turn,
|
||||
is the lead token of the surrounding construct. The command
|
||||
@code{backward-sexp} jumps from a token to its parent, but there are
|
||||
some caveats: for @emph{openers} (tokens which start a construct, like
|
||||
@code{if}), you need to start with point before the token, while for
|
||||
others you need to start with point after the token.
|
||||
@code{backward-sexp} stops with point before the parent token if that is
|
||||
the @emph{opener} of the token of interest, and otherwise it stops with
|
||||
point after the parent token.
|
||||
|
||||
SMIE indentation rules are specified using a function that takes two
|
||||
arguments @var{method} and @var{arg} where the meaning of @var{arg} and the
|
||||
expected return value depend on @var{method}.
|
||||
|
||||
@var{method} can be:
|
||||
@itemize
|
||||
@item
|
||||
@code{:after}, in which case @var{arg} is a token and the function
|
||||
should return the @var{offset} to use for indentation after @var{arg}.
|
||||
@item
|
||||
@code{:before}, in which case @var{arg} is a token and the function
|
||||
should return the @var{offset} to use to indent @var{arg} itself.
|
||||
@item
|
||||
@code{:elem}, in which case the function should return either the offset
|
||||
to use to indent function arguments (if @var{arg} is the symbol
|
||||
@code{arg}) or the basic indentation step (if @var{arg} is the symbol
|
||||
@code{basic}).
|
||||
@item
|
||||
@code{:list-intro}, in which case @var{arg} is a token and the function
|
||||
should return non-@code{nil} if the token is followed by a list of
|
||||
expressions (not separated by any token) rather than an expression.
|
||||
@end itemize
|
||||
|
||||
When @var{arg} is a token, the function is called with point just before
|
||||
that token. A return value of nil always means to fallback on the
|
||||
default behavior, so the function should return nil for arguments it
|
||||
does not expect.
|
||||
|
||||
@var{offset} can be:
|
||||
@itemize
|
||||
@item
|
||||
@code{nil}: use the default indentation rule.
|
||||
@item
|
||||
@code{(column . @var{column})}: indent to column @var{column}.
|
||||
@item
|
||||
@var{number}: offset by @var{number}, relative to a base token which is
|
||||
the current token for @code{:after} and its parent for @code{:before}.
|
||||
@end itemize
|

@node SMIE Indentation Helpers
|
||||
@subsubsection Helper Functions for Indentation Rules
|
||||
|
||||
SMIE provides various functions designed specifically for use in the
|
||||
indentation rules function (several of those functions break if used in
|
||||
another context). These functions all start with the prefix
|
||||
@code{smie-rule-}.
|
||||
|
||||
@defun smie-rule-bolp
|
||||
Return non-@code{nil} if the current token is the first on the line.
|
||||
@end defun
|
||||
|
||||
@defun smie-rule-hanging-p
|
||||
Return non-@code{nil} if the current token is @emph{hanging}.
|
||||
A token is @emph{hanging} if it is the last token on the line
|
||||
and if it is preceded by other tokens: a lone token on a line is not
|
||||
hanging.
|
||||
@end defun
|
||||
|
||||
@defun smie-rule-next-p &rest tokens
|
||||
Return non-@code{nil} if the next token is among @var{tokens}.
|
||||
@end defun
|
||||
|
||||
@defun smie-rule-prev-p &rest tokens
|
||||
Return non-@code{nil} if the previous token is among @var{tokens}.
|
||||
@end defun
|
||||
|
||||
@defun smie-rule-parent-p &rest parents
|
||||
Return non-@code{nil} if the current token's parent is among @var{parents}.
|
||||
@end defun
|
||||
|
||||
@defun smie-rule-sibling-p
|
||||
Return non-nil if the current token's parent is actually a sibling.
|
||||
This is the case for example when the parent of a @code{","} is just the
|
||||
previous @code{","}.
|
||||
@end defun
|
||||
|
||||
@defun smie-rule-parent &optional offset
|
||||
Return the proper offset to align the current token with the parent.
|
||||
If non-@code{nil}, @var{offset} should be an integer giving an
|
||||
additional offset to apply.
|
||||
@end defun
|
||||
|
||||
@defun smie-rule-separator method
|
||||
Indent current token as a @emph{separator}.
|
||||
|
||||
By @emph{separator}, we mean here a token whose sole purpose is to
|
||||
separate various elements within some enclosing syntactic construct, and
|
||||
which does not have any semantic significance in itself (i.e. it would
|
||||
typically not exist as a node in an abstract syntax tree).
|
||||
|
||||
Such a token is expected to have an associative syntax and be closely
|
||||
tied to its syntactic parent. Typical examples are @code{","} in lists
|
||||
of arguments (enclosed inside parentheses), or @code{";"} in sequences
|
||||
of instructions (enclosed in a @code{@{...@}} or @code{begin...end}
|
||||
block).
|
||||
|
||||
@var{method} should be the method name that was passed to
|
||||
`smie-rules-function'.
|
||||
@end defun
|

@node SMIE Indentation Example
|
||||
@subsubsection Sample Indentation Rules
|
||||
|
||||
Here is an example of an indentation function:
|
||||
|
||||
@example
|
||||
(eval-when-compile (require 'cl)) ;For the `case' macro.
|
||||
(defun sample-smie-rules (kind token)
|
||||
(case kind
|
||||
(:elem (case token
|
||||
(basic sample-indent-basic)))
|
||||
(:after
|
||||
(cond
|
||||
((equal token ",") (smie-rule-separator kind))
|
||||
((equal token ":=") sample-indent-basic)))
|
||||
(:before
|
||||
(cond
|
||||
((equal token ",") (smie-rule-separator kind))
|
||||
((member token '("begin" "(" "@{"))
|
||||
(if (smie-rule-hanging-p) (smie-rule-parent)))
|
||||
((equal token "if")
|
||||
(and (not (smie-rule-bolp)) (smie-rule-prev-p "else")
|
||||
(smie-rule-parent)))))))
|
||||
@end example
|
||||
|
||||
@noindent
|
||||
A few things to note:
|
||||
|
||||
@itemize
|
||||
@item
|
||||
The first case indicates the basic indentation increment to use.
|
||||
If @code{sample-indent-basic} is nil, then SMIE uses the global
|
||||
setting @code{smie-indent-basic}. The major mode could have set
|
||||
@code{smie-indent-basic} buffer-locally instead, but that
|
||||
is discouraged.
|
||||
|
||||
@item
|
||||
The two (identical) rules for the token @code{","} make SMIE try to be
|
||||
more clever when the comma separator is placed at the beginning of
|
||||
lines. It tries to outdent the separator so as to align the code after
|
||||
the comma; for example:
|
||||
|
||||
@example
|
||||
x = longfunctionname (
|
||||
arg1
|
||||
, arg2
|
||||
);
|
||||
@end example
|
||||
|
||||
@item
|
||||
The rule for indentation after @code{":="} exists because otherwise
|
||||
SMIE would treat @code{":="} as an infix operator and would align the
|
||||
right argument with the left one.
|
||||
|
||||
@item
|
||||
The rule for indentation before @code{"begin"} is an example of the use
|
||||
of virtual indentation: This rule is used only when @code{"begin"} is
|
||||
hanging, which can happen only when @code{"begin"} is not at the
|
||||
beginning of a line. So this is not used when indenting
|
||||
@code{"begin"} itself but only when indenting something relative to this
|
||||
@code{"begin"}. Concretely, this rule changes the indentation from:
|
||||
|
||||
@example
|
||||
if x > 0 then begin
|
||||
dosomething(x);
|
||||
end
|
||||
@end example
|
||||
to
|
||||
@example
|
||||
if x > 0 then begin
|
||||
dosomething(x);
|
||||
end
|
||||
@end example
|
||||
|
||||
@item
|
||||
The rule for indentation before @code{"if"} is similar to the one for
|
||||
@code{"begin"}, but where the purpose is to treat @code{"else if"}
|
||||
as a single unit, so as to align a sequence of tests rather than indent
|
||||
each test further to the right. This function does this only in the
|
||||
case where the @code{"if"} is not placed on a separate line, hence the
|
||||
@code{smie-rule-bolp} test.
|
||||
|
||||
If we know that the @code{"else"} is always aligned with its @code{"if"}
|
||||
and is always at the beginning of a line, we can use a more efficient
|
||||
rule:
|
||||
@example
|
||||
((equal token "if")
|
||||
(and (not (smie-rule-bolp)) (smie-rule-prev-p "else")
|
||||
(save-excursion
|
||||
(sample-smie-backward-token) ;Jump before the "else".
|
||||
(cons 'column (current-column)))))
|
||||
@end example
|
||||
|
||||
The advantage of this formulation is that it reuses the indentation of
|
||||
the previous @code{"else"}, rather than going all the way back to the
|
||||
first @code{"if"} of the sequence.
|
||||
@end itemize
|
